One labour dispute at Haskins in 2018

18 Feb 2019

Minister of Employment, Labour Productivity and Skills Development, Mr Tshenolo Mabeo says during 2018 only one labour dispute involving unfair dismissal at Haskins (Pty) Ltd was reported to the labour office on July 4, 2018. Minister Mabeo said the dispute was mediated on August 8, 2018 whereupon the parties failed to reach a settlement.

He said a certificate of failure to settle was issued on the same date for either party to refer the dispute to the Industrial Court for adjudication. Member of Parliament for Gaborone North, Mr Haskins Nkaigwa had asked the minister if he was aware of the abuse suffered by employees of Haskins (Pty) Ltd at the hands of the operations and marketing manager.

He also wanted the minister to say how many labour cases had been reported to the ministry concerning the company. He also asked the minister if he was aware of the racist remarks directed to employees by the said manager, and what was being done about the misconduct. “My ministry has not received any complaints regarding racist remarks directed to employees by the said manager,” Minister Mabeo further answered.
